java配置的环境变量有哪些

java配置的环境变量有哪些

作者:Rhett Bai发布时间:2026-04-13 22:01阅读时长:14 分钟阅读次数:3
常见问答
Q
如何设置Java的环境变量以便在命令行中运行?

我想在命令行中直接使用Java命令,需要配置哪些环境变量?具体设置步骤是什么?

A

配置Java环境变量的关键步骤

要在命令行运行Java程序,需配置以下环境变量:

  1. JAVA_HOME:指向Java安装目录,如C:\Program Files\Java\jdk1.8.0_241。
  2. Path:在Path环境变量中添加%JAVA_HOME%\bin路径,方便执行java和javac命令。

设置方法是在系统环境变量中添加或修改这些变量,配置后打开新的命令行窗口检查java -version是否正确显示。

Q
环境变量配置不正确会导致哪些Java运行问题?

如果我没有正确配置Java的环境变量,会有哪些常见错误或者影响?

A

环境变量配置错误可能引发的问题

未正确配置环境变量时,可能出现以下问题:

  • 命令行执行java或javac时提示“命令找不到”或“不是内部或外部命令”。
  • 系统无法定位JDK或JRE,导致Java程序无法编译或运行。
  • 使用IDE时,如果引用系统Java路径错误,也会出现无法识别或版本冲突等问题。

因此正确设置JAVA_HOME及Path变量对于Java开发必不可少。

Q
在多版本Java环境下如何配置环境变量?

我的电脑上安装了多个Java版本,如何合理配置环境变量方便切换?

A

多版本Java环境变量配置建议

可以通过修改JAVA_HOME变量指向当前使用的Java版本安装路径,同时更新Path中对应的bin目录。例如:

  • 设置JAVA_HOME为JDK1.8路径时,Path中加入%JAVA_HOME%\bin。
  • 需要切换到JDK11,改变JAVA_HOME变量指向JDK11目录。

为了简化切换,可以编写批处理脚本或使用工具管理不同版本,保证每次启动环境变量配置正确。